The Fierce Competition Between the University of Alabama and Auburn University in College Football

The rivalry between the University of Alabama and Auburn University is one of the most intense and historic in college football. Known as the Iron Bowl, this annual game captures the passion of fans from both schools and has a deep-rooted history dating back over a century.

Historical Background of the Rivalry

The rivalry began in 1893, making it one of the oldest in college sports. Originally, the games were sporadic, but as both programs grew in prominence, the rivalry intensified. Over the decades, the Iron Bowl has become a defining moment each college football season in Alabama.

Key Moments and Memorable Games

Several games stand out in the history of the rivalry. In 1972, Auburn’s victory was considered a major upset, and in 2013, the game was pivotal in Alabama’s quest for a national championship. The rivalry is marked by dramatic finishes, fierce competition, and passionate fans.

Traditions and Celebrations

Both universities have unique traditions associated with the game. Fans wear school colors—crimson and white for Alabama, orange and blue for Auburn—and participate in pep rallies, parades, and tailgating. The game day atmosphere is electric, with chants, cheers, and spirited displays of school pride.
